Clarifiers are positively charged liquids that attract loose suspended particles like dead algae,
bacteria, dead skin, and other particles with a negative charge. By making these particles larger,
they become much easier to trap by the filtration system.
Clarifier will only work if your pool's water chemistry is balanced. If your water is super-saturated
(i.e. high pH/alkalinity/calcium hardness) it will reject calcium and no clarifier will work to remedy this.
To prevent this condition, balance the water accordingly in this order:
- Alkalinity 80-120 ppm
- pH 7.2-7.6
- Calcium 200-400 ppm
Once the water is balanced, add the recommended
dosage of water clarifier to the pool. For sand filters,
add 3 cups of either Diatomaceous Earth or
Purifiber directly to the skimmer. This will greatly
enhance the filter's ability to trap smaller particles.
For cartridge and D.E. filters, this step should not
be necessary.
